Product Overview

The ATOMFAIR® EB60KG-5G-01 is a high-performance platform scale configured for High-capacity material determination, rugged logistics verification, with 60 kg maximum capacity and 5 g readability. It delivers ±5 g repeatability, ±10 g linearity.
Built with a load cell, it supports precision weighing control for the stated measurement range.
Its overload protection supports stable weighing performance. Built-in operating functions include piece counting, percentage weighing, multi-unit conversion, tare. The communication configuration includes a standard RS232 communication interface. Technical Specifications (MP60K)

PARAMETER DETAILS
1. Metrology & Structural Design
Model Reference EB60KG-5G-01 Heavy Precision Interface
Maximum Weighing Capacity 60 kg
Readability (d) 5 g
Repeatability ±5 g
Linearity Error ±10 g
Platter Dimensions Form Factor 400 × 500 mm Reinforced Stainless Platform

Full MP Industrial Scale Cross-Reference Matrix

PROJECT EB60KG-1G-01 EB100KG-1G-01 EB60KG-5G-01 EB100KG-5G-01 EB150KG-10G EB200KG-10G-01 EB300KG-10G-01
Capacity (kg) 60 100 60 100 150 200 300
Readability (g) 1 1 5 5 10 10 10
Repeatability (g) ±1 ±1 ±5 ±5 ±10 ±10 ±10
Linearity (g) ±2 ±2 ±10 ±10 ±20 ±20 ±20
Pan Size (mm) 400×500 400×500 400×500 400×500 400×500 400×500 400×500
